On Sunday morning around 5:00 a.m., the community near Queen City and Domino in Cass County was rocked by a devastating blaze at the Punj Truck Stop and Indian Restaurant. Two people were found dead on the second story of the building after a fire engulfed a quarter of the structure on U.S. Highway 59. The Liberty Eylau Fire Department, the Atlanta Fire Department, and the Texarkana Fire Department all converged on the scene to battle the flames, but for the victims inside, the help came too late.
